Appropriate Preposition:

  • Rob of ( অপহরণ করা ) Somebody robbed him of his purse.
  • Lack of ( অভাব ) I have no lack of friends.
  • Liable to ( দায়ী ) He is liable to fine for his misconduct.
  • Wait for ( অপেক্ষা করা ) I waited for him for two hours.
  • Escape by ( রক্ষা করা ) He escaped by a hair breadth.
  • Adjacent to ( সংলগ্ন ) Her college is adjacent to her house.

Idioms:

  • Bird of a feather ( এক রকম স্বভাবের লোক ) Birds of a feather flock together.
  • Cock and bull story ( গাঁজাখুরি গল্প ) Nobody will believe your cock and bull story
  • By far ( সর্বাংশে ) He is by far the best boy in the class.
  • From A to Z ( প্রথম হইতে শেষ পয্র্ন্ত ) The statement is true from A to Z.
  • Of course ( অবশ্যই ) Of course, you know what that means
  • Out of date ( অপ্রচলিত ) This fashion is now out of date.
